Product Specifications

Power Handling: 200 wattsCD CD-R/RW and MP3 playback 100 watts x 2 min RMS per channel into 6 ohms from 100Hz-20kHz 10% THD 2-line text for MP3 navigation 40 AM/FM digital tuner presets Full logic double cassette with 4 color fluorescent display Includes full function remote
